A tank of white liquor imploded at Nippon Dynawave Packaging Company’s facility in southern Washington state on Tuesday, leading to fatalities and multiple missing workers. The incident has prompted an investigation by safety regulators and raised concerns about operational risks in the pulp and paper industry.

According to reports from Forbes, a tank containing white liquor—a critical chemical used in the pulp manufacturing process—imploded at the Nippon Dynawave Packaging Company mill in southern Washington on Tuesday. The incident resulted in confirmed fatalities and several workers remain unaccounted for. Emergency response teams were dispatched to the scene, and local authorities have launched a coordinated search and rescue operation. Nippon Dynawave, a packaging material producer, has not yet released an official statement regarding the cause of the implosion or the full extent of casualties. The company operates several paper and packaging facilities in the region, and this incident marks one of the most severe safety events in the industry in recent years. The exact sequence of events leading to the tank failure is under investigation by state and federal safety agencies, including the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A). White liquor, a highly caustic sodium hydroxide solution, is essential for breaking down wood chips into pulp; a rupture of this nature can lead to rapid chemical release and pose severe health and environmental hazards.

The incident underscores the inherent risks associated with handling hazardous chemicals in industrial pulp and paper operations. Key takeaways from the event include potential operational disruptions at the Nippon Dynawave mill, which may affect its production capacity in the short term. The investigation could result in temporary shutdowns or mandated safety retrofits, imposing additional costs on the company. Furthermore, the lack of immediate official communication from the firm may heighten uncertainty among stakeholders regarding liability, regulatory fines, and potential litigation from affected families. The broader pulp and paper sector could face renewed scrutiny over safety protocols, particularly concerning storage vessel integrity and emergency response preparedness. Industry analysts suggest that such incidents may lead to tighter regulations across the sector, increasing compliance costs for all major producers.
